As fast as we are going to play and as good as the defenses will be that we face this year...I think Diara and Harvey are going to struggle with quick decisions. Harvey is a frosh so maybe he will start to adjust to the speed very soon...I hope so...WAY too early to tell on him (so I will give him the benefit of the doubt). But Diara has been in the program and the faster he goes the worse it seems to get. I was (and still am) hoping he could be a big factor this year. Hoping it was just one of those games to forget but it was Thomas More.

Cronin wanted to slow the game down and now I understand why in some respects. Brannen wants to speed it up so he needs to keep recruiting kids with high BB IQ or just smart kids in general. McNeal is smart and can play at a fast pace (for example). Both Cumberlands have high BB IQ and just have those instincts you need.

Struggling to pick up a new system is one thing (let's say Williams)...but struggling to make quick decisions on the fly? You either have that or you don't. My guess is Harvey has the instincts to figure it out. Diara right now is a big question mark IMO.
